The European Space Agency‘s Rosetta space probe has undergone checkout and modification at Arianespace‘s spaceport in French Guiana in preparation for its new launch date on a mission to catch a comet.

Rosetta was assigned a new comet target – 67P/Churyumov-Gerasimenko – after its original January 2002 launch on Ariane 5 was postponed. Liftoff now is targeted for February, with the spacecraft scheduled to encounter Churyumov-Gerasimenko in November 2014.
